Job description

We’re seeking a full-time controls engineer to join our expanding team and contribute to the design, programming, and management of automation projects in the pharmaceutical and food & beverage industries. LAPORTE is a consulting engineering firm which has been in business for 25 years. Today, the company has 25 offices across North America and Europe, and over 480 employees with a passion for engineering.

Join us for a competitive salary, compensatory PTO, comprehensive benefits, and a supportive work environment that emphasizes professional growth. We believe in a flexible working environment that values work-life balance while encouraging efficiency and creativity on a daily basis.

The Controls Engineer will:

  • Lead and support the design of automation projects, developing specifications for control panels, networks, and software (primarily Allen-Bradley PLC/PACs and Factorytalk View ME/SE HMI and SCADA).
  • Translate process or packaging applications into detailed construction packages for control panel designs and electrical installation scopes. Construction packages typical include equipment arrangement drawings, schematics, wiring diagrams, cable schedules, control panel drawings, etc.
  • Mentor and supervise project team members, enhancing team collaboration and project execution.
  • Provide comprehensive lifecycle support for projects, including system design, troubleshooting, testing, and commissioning.
  • Perform site surveys and offer hands-on support during installation, focusing on control system deployment.
  • Adhere to and ensure compliance with relevant codes (UL508A, NEC) and standards.
  • Engage in diverse projects, enhancing your engineering and project management skills.
  • Travel expectations are dependent on specific project requirements by typically require 1-3 days for an initial site visit and then a return trip to lead commissioning efforts which may take 1-4 weeks. Overall travel is anticipated to be 20-40%.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in chemical eng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or Electrical Engineering Technology.
  • 2-6 years of experience in control systems, manufacturing, or consulting-design environments including experience commissioning systems, preferably as a lead.
  • Proficient in automation project tasks including design, client coordination, and bid package preparation.
  • Skilled in control panel and network design, instrument selection, and control system programming.
  • Proficiency with AutoCAD for control panel design and electrical construction packages.
  • Familiarity / Experience with electrical engineering construction packages – single line diagrams, panel schedules, power plans, etc.
  • Hands-on experience surveying existing control installations and preparing as-built conditions of systems.
  • Experience surveying and planning control systems projects without support of a manager.
  • Hands-on experience with Rockwell Automation software—Studio 5000 / RSLogix 5000 for PLC programming and FactoryTalk View ME / SE for HMI and SCADA development.
